Pandiarajan’s son badly injured

Prithvi, the actor-director’s son, got into a serious fire accident during the shooting of his debut film in Tamil.

From our online archive

CHENNAI: South Indian actor-director Pandiarajan’s son Prithvi was seriously injured in an accident while filming a song sequence for his debut film, ‘Pathinettan Kudi’.

The actor was admitted to the Apollo Hospital in Madurai. Doctors treating him have said that his injuries are serious.

Prithvi suffered serious burns in the fire accident on the sets.

Crew members say that the fire accident happened due to excess petrol that was used to create the ring of fire that Prithvi had to enter. The fire caught on and rapidly and went out of control. Nobody else however was injured in the accident.

Padiarajan and the rest of the family have rushed to Madurai.
